Trojans Will Open Tourney At Queens

ANDERSON, S.C. -- The Anderson University men's soccer team will travel to Queens University of Charlotte Tuesday for a first-round match in the 2007 Conference Carolinas Tournament. Anderson, 8-10 overall, is the No. 7 seed in the tournament. No. 2 seeded Queens, 8-5-3 overall, beat Anderson, 3-0 at Anderson on Oct. 18. In the first round of last year's conference tournament, the two teams battled to a scoreless tie. Queens earned the right to advance on penalty kicks. Anderson enters the match playing its best soccer of the season. The Trojans have won four of their last five matches. The match will start at 7 p.m. The winner will advance to the semifinals Friday at Mount Olive.
